The weapons durability bothered me at first. I kept thinking I'd eventually be able to repair them or something. Eventually I realized it was kind of fun because it forces you to try new weapons constantly. The only mechanics that I find tedious are buying/selling and cooking. I'd way rather a Skyrim style interface to set up a transaction with all the items you want and then confirm it. BOTW is exhausting when you want to unload a bunch of junk or cook 100 hearty durians. |

I also really don't like the BotW cooking mechanic, but mostly because it's so tedious to sit through the mini cooking cut-scene.
Cooking and crafting in Stardew Valley have zero ceremony, you just click on the recipe and boom you're done, it's exactly as fast as any other inventory operation.
I don't know why certain cooked foods in BotW stack and some don't. Searing meat is a good way of stacking up a huge amount of cooked food, because it stacks.
